The Itinerary in Detail
Stop 1: Pub Street
Your journey begins here, passing the heart of Siem Reap’s nightlife. The tour doesn’t Dwell long at each stop but offers great views of this iconic area, famous for its vibrant bars, street performers, and energetic atmosphere. Many reviews mention how perfect it is for getting a feel of the lively scene without the chaos. Simone_S called it “a great local experience,” highlighting how it’s an ideal way to get your bearings before exploring further on your own.
Passing the Old Market and Night Market
Depending on traffic and timing, the tour might pass in front of the Night Market and Old Market. These spots are fantastic for browsing local crafts, souvenirs, and street food stalls. Though you won’t have time to shop during the ride, seeing them from the bike gives a glimpse into local life and commerce.
Riverside Drive
Cruising past Siem Reap Riverside offers a serene view of the river with some of the best sunset vistas. Many travelers mention how the riverside backdrop makes the whole experience more picturesque and relaxing, especially as the sun begins to dip below the horizon.
The Experience of Riding and Drinking
The bike is equipped with a mobile bar, and the host, TT (a standout according to reviews), keeps the mood lively and friendly. Pedaling is optional, which means you can focus on socializing and enjoying the sights. The music choice is up to you, creating a personalized soundtrack to your ride.
With unlimited ice-cold beer, vodka, gin, rum, and soft drinks, you’ll have plenty to keep you refreshed. Reviewers like Simone_S emphasized how “TT had the perfect personality for the job,” making the tour more engaging and fun. The soft drinks provide a non-alcoholic option, allowing everyone to join in the good times.
Weather
Raincoats are provided, so even if the skies threaten, you won’t be caught unprepared. However, since the tour is weather-dependent, a rainy day could mean rescheduling or a full refund.
Group Size and Booking
With a maximum of 12 travelers, this tour maintains an intimate vibe, allowing the guide to give personalized attention. Booking is typically done a week in advance, indicating its popularity. You can opt for a single seat or book the entire bike if traveling with friends or family.

Practical Considerations
The tour runs daily from 11 am to 7 pm, giving you flexibility to slot it into your trip. Since it lasts only about two hours, it’s perfect for an evening activity or a fun afternoon break. Just remember to book in advance, especially during peak season, as the tour is quite popular.

FAQ

Is this tour suitable for all ages?
Yes, most travelers can participate, and it’s a casual experience suitable for adults. Service animals are also allowed.
How long does the tour last?
Approximately 2 hours, including the stops around key spots like Pub Street and the Riverside.
What’s included in the price?
Unlimited al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ks, a mobile ticket, a designated driver, a host, and raincoats if necessary.
Can I book for just myself or my group?
Yes, you can book a single seat or the whole bike for your group, up to 12 travelers max.
What should I wear?
Comfortable casual clothing suitable for biking and weather conditions; raincoats are provided if it rains.
Are the drinks really unlimited?
Yes, you can enjoy as many icy cold beers, vodka, gin, rum, and soft drinks as you like during the tour.
Is pedaling required?
Pedaling is optional; many passengers prefer to relax and let the driver take the wheel.
What’s the best time to do the tour?
Most travelers choose the late afternoon or early evening to catch the sunset and enjoy the cooler temperatures.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ours in advance, offering peace of mind for spontaneous plans.
